  3. Glorious MysteriesReflected on Wednesday and Sunday The Glorious Mysteries reveal the mediation of the great Virgin, still more abundant in fruitfulness. She rejoices in heart over the glory of her Son triumphant over death, and follows Him with a mother's love in His Ascension to His eternal kingdom; but, though worthy of Heaven, she abides a while on earth, so that the infant Church may be directed and comforted by her "who penetrated, beyond all belief, into the deep secrets of Divine wisdom" (St. Bernard).      ..... Pope Leo XIII

  4. 1st Glorious Mystery The Resurrection: Jesus rises from the dead.

  5. MONDAY • Our Father…. • Hail Mary… (x 10) • Glory be…. • Fatima Prayer… (O my Jesus…)

  6. 2nd Glorious Mystery The Ascension into Heaven: Jesus ascends into Heaven.

  7. TUESDAY • Our Father…. • Hail Mary… (x 10) • Glory be…. • Fatima Prayer… (O my Jesus…)

  8. 3rd Glorious Mystery The Descent of the Holy Spirit: The Holy Spirit comes to the apostles and the Blessed Mother.

  9. WEDNESDAY • Our Father…. • Hail Mary… (x 10) • Glory be…. • Fatima Prayer… (O my Jesus…)

  10. 4th Glorious Mystery The Assumption: The Mother of Jesus is takeninto Heaven.

  11. THURSDAY • Our Father…. • Hail Mary… (x 10) • Glory be… • Fatima Prayer… (O my Jesus…)

  12. 5th Glorious Mystery The Coronation: Mary is crowned Queen of Heaven and Earth.

  13. FRIDAY • Our Father…. • Hail Mary… (x 10) • Glory be…. • Fatima Prayer… (O my Jesus…) • Hail Holy Queen…
